Movies of Kenner G. Kemp and Shepperd Strudwick together
Kenner G. Kemp and Shepperd Strudwick have starred in 3 movies together. Their first film was All the King's Men in 1949. The most recent movie that Kenner G. Kemp and Shepperd Strudwick starred together was A Place in the Sun in 1951.
